> On 07/28/2012 07:42 PM, Jiang Liu wrote:
>> +int acpihp_register_slot(struct acpihp_slot *slot)
>> +{
>> + int ret;
>> + char *name;
>> + size_t off;
>> +
>> + if (!slot || !slot->slot_ops)
>> + return -EINVAL;
>> +
>> + /* Hook top level hotplug slots under ACPI root device */
>> + if (slot->parent)
>> + slot->dev.parent = &slot->parent->dev;
>> + else
>> + slot->dev.parent = &acpi_root->dev;
>> +
>> + ret = device_add(&slot->dev);
>> + if (!ret) {
>> + slot->flags |= ACPIHP_SLOT_FLAG_REGISTERED;
>> + name = kmalloc(PAGE_SIZE, GFP_KERNEL);
>> + if (name) {
>> + off = acpihp_generate_link_name(slot, name, 0);
>> + name[off - 1] = '\0';
>> + sysfs_create_link(&acpihp_slot_kset->kobj,
>> + &slot->dev.kobj, name);
>
> I got a compiler warning here:
> CC drivers/acpi/hotplug/core.o
> drivers/acpi/hotplug/core.c: In function ‘acpihp_register_slot’:
> drivers/acpi/hotplug/core.c:199: warning: ignoring return value of ‘sysfs_create_link’, declared with attribute warn_unused_result
>
> Seems that we need to check the sysfs_create_link()'s return value here, and if it fails,
> shall we at least give a warning message here ?
